Job Title: Civil Rights Investigator

Location: 100 N. Senate Ave. Rm N 300, Indianapolis, IN 46204

Duration: 6-Month Contract


Purpose of Position/Summary:

Civil Rights Investigator, where you will play a crucial role in investigating allegations of discriminatory practices under the Civil Rights Act. Your responsibilities will include gathering and analyzing relevant documents through interviews and onsite investigations, preparing detailed written summaries, and making recommendations on whether there is probable cause to believe a discriminatory act occurred.

Essential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Conduct interviews with complainants, respondents, and witnesses via phone, in the office, or onsite, using accepted investigative principles.
  • Analyze information from interviews, comparative data, and statistics.
  • Prepare concise written case analyses, including relevant facts, interviews, observations, and conclusions.
  • Manage a caseload, ensuring no more than 9% of cases are "aged" (180+ days) and submit a minimum of eight (8) cases per month.
  • Maintain up-to-date case file records, including both paper and online case management systems.
  • Develop effective working relationships with coworkers, clients, and the public, and provide education and training on Civil Rights Laws and ICRC operations.
  • Perform legal administrative support duties and related tasks as required.

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ree required.
  • Thorough knowledge of and ability to interpret and apply Indiana Civil Rights Law, Commission rules and regulations, and relevant court decisions.
  • Specialized understanding of Civil Rights principles, practices, and trends at both state and national levels.
  • Ability to secure and analyze data and testimony related to Indiana Civil Rights Law, especially in employment cases.
  • Proficient in conducting complex investigations and making recommendations to the director.
  • Strong understanding of legal concepts and their application to specific cases.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ality.
  • Proficiency with computers and Microsoft Office 365.
